Wairarapa Organics was formed mid-2000 by a group of Wairarapa growers, retailers and consumers. This group recognised the need to improve access to the knowledge and skills necessary for successful organic food production and marketing. Wairarapa Organics also aims to present the benefits of organic products to the people of the Wairarapa convincingly. Wairarapa Organics is a non-profit incorporated Society.

Wairarapa Organics aims to:

• Promote, encourage and support activities which will increase the level of organic production, marketing and consumption in the Wairarapa region.

• Collect and disseminate information on subjects of interest to existing and future organic producers, consumers and other interested parties.

• Actively seek the support of both Governmental and non-governmental organisations which can assist the Society to neet its goals.

• Assist the individuals and corporate bodies to meet their goals in relation to organic production, marketing and consumption.
